과제 체크포인트
배포 링크
https://jungwoo0203.github.io/front_6th_chapter1-3/
기본과제
equalities
- shallowEquals 구현 완료
- deepEquals 구현 완료
hooks
- useRef 구현 완료
- useMemo 구현 완료
- useCallback 구현 완료
- useDeepMemo 구현 완료
- useShallowState 구현 완료
- useAutoCallback 구현 완료
High Order Components
- memo 구현 완료
- deepMemo 구현 완료
심화 과제
hooks
- createObserver를 useSyncExternalStore에 사용하기 적합한 코드로 개선
- useShallowSelector 구현
- useStore 구현
- useRouter 구현
- useStorage 구현
context
- ToastContext, ModalContext 개선
과제 셀프회고
기술적 성장
자랑하고 싶은 코드
개선이 필요하다고 생각하는 코드
학습 효과 분석
과제 피드백
학습 갈무리
리액트의 렌더링이 어떻게 이루어지는지 정리해주세요.
메모이제이션에 대한 나의 생각을 적어주세요.
컨텍스트와 상태관리에 대한 나의 생각을 적어주세요.
리뷰 받고 싶은 내용
과제 피드백
안녕하세요 정우님~ 3주차 과제 잘 진행해주셨네요 ㅎㅎ 고생하셨습니다!
다만 과제 PR에는 내용이 많이 없어서 아쉽네요 ㅠㅠ 많이 바쁘셔서 그런거겠죠!? 저도 백엔드 과제 불합격이라 어떤 심정인지 알 것 같아요. 그래도 다음에는 잘 작성해주세요~! 화이팅입니다!